Before You Hire
- Confirm the license is Active and hasn't expired.
- Check that bond and insurance are current - dates are listed above. Bond and insurance cover different risks →
- Confirm the RMI (Responsible Managing Individual) will be on-site.
- Always get a written contract referencing CCB license #209429.
- Cross-verify with the official CCB database - data here may have a delay.
- CCB Lookup does not include complaint or disciplinary history. For complaint records, check the official CCB search →
Protect your home improvement project
Surety bond protection
Oregon's surety bond covers incomplete or defective work up to the bond limit. File a claim with the Oregon CCB within 2 years of project completion. How to file a bond claim →
General liability insurance
General liability covers property damage and bodily injury during the project. Ask for a COI (Certificate of Insurance) listing your address as an additional insured location.
Written contract required
Oregon law requires a written contract for residential projects over $2,000. It must include the CCB number, scope of work, and payment schedule. Contract requirements →
Workers' compensation coverage
Contractors with employees in Oregon are required to carry workers' compensation insurance. If a worker is injured on your property without coverage, you may bear liability. Verify coverage status before work begins.
